= Review =

Good:

- rpmlint checks return:

hibernate-jpa-2.1-api.src: W: invalid-url URL: http://www.hibernate.org/ HTTP
Error 403: Forbidden
hibernate-jpa-2.1-api.noarch: W: invalid-url URL: http://www.hibernate.org/
HTTP Error 403: Forbidden
hibernate-jpa-2.1-api-javadoc.noarch: W: invalid-url URL:
http://www.hibernate.org/ HTTP Error 403: Forbidden

All safe to ignore. Weird, but fine. :)

- package meets naming guidelines
- package meets packaging guidelines
- license (EPL and BSD) OK, text in %doc, matches source
- spec file legible, in am. english
- source matches upstream
(675e7365e4c014369aeb62a284644c7fcb9a166e634c7466a05200f71fab1d99)
- package compiles on f19 (noarch)
- no missing BR
- no unnecessary BR
- no locales
- not relocatable
- owns all directories that it creates
- no duplicate files
- permissions ok
- macro use consistent
- code, not content
- -javadocs ok
- nothing in %doc affects runtime
- no need for .desktop file

APPROVED.
